What’s the best way to keep squirrels from digging in my raised bed gardens?

I ended up putting a electric wire around my gardens for this..I have 3 pecan trees so we have plenty of squirrels..They no longer tromp through my garden to get to the nuts now..once shocked..they learn quickly..this whole fence system cost me about 40.00 total..wire,control box, and insulators too to do over 200 feet of [...]

which wood could be used for raised bed vegetable gardening to discourage bugs?

Cedar, Juniper, and Redwood all tend to discourage bugs.
Cedar is best. That is why cedar chests are used to store clothing and linens and such, and Cedar is used to line closets to discourage moths. Cedar "bender boards" are used as borders between flowerbeds and lawns, as are those made from Redwood, because [...]

Can I make a raised bed garden with cinder blocks?

Concrete leaches alkali material when it gets wet. Do I need to take any precautions in order to grow vegetables (tomato, pepper, bean) to keep the soil pH from getting too high?
My garden is made with cinder blocks. Just get a soil test every year and then you’ll know how the soil is doing [...]
